Outdoor Theatre: The Tale of Jemima Puddleduck
A perfect summer holiday treat for younger audiences and new for 2024, Quantum presents a delightful new adaptation of Beatrix Potter’s much-loved tale, 'The Tale of Jemima Puddle-Duck'.
- Booking essential
Prevented from hatching her eggs at the farm, foolish Jemima goes in search of a nesting place in the forest and soon she meets a charming 'whiskery gentleman’ who offers her the perfect nesting place in his woodshed.
But why is the woodshed full of feathers? And why is he asking her to collect herbs for roast duck?
Back at the farm the Collie-dog, Kep, puts two and two together, but will he be in time to rescue Jemima from her fate?
